- [ ] Step 7: Archive cold storage buckets (Glacierline tier). Confirm both ceremony witnesses are present, verify bucket manifests match the Oxbow ledger, then seal the archive key shares. Plugin authors may observe but not handle shares. Once sealed, the archive index itself is encrypted and can only be reopened with the passphrase below.

vault phrase of badup-hahig = tamael-aldael-kelmir-istael-fenok-istwyn-tamius-jorath-oliion

MEMO — Insurance Renewal. Heads of department: our commercial cover with Almsworth Mutual renews on the first of next month. Premiums rise 6%, reflecting last year's warehouse claim at the Pellbridge site. Coverage terms are otherwise unchanged. Submit updated asset registers by the 20th to avoid gaps. Related planning considerations are set out below.

management briefing: Goroxix Systems is in early talks to buy Kelethek Holdings for about $118.0 million. The Sileth launch date is February 25, and nothing goes to the press before then. Legal wants the Pelokox Logistics term sheet withdrawn before December 14.

Subject: Quickstore 4.2 — bloom filter now fronts the KV layer

Plugin authors: starting with this release, Quickstore places a bloom filter ahead of the key-value store. Negative lookups return faster; false positives fall through safely. No API changes are required on your side. Verify your plugin against the staging build referenced below.

session token of fahif-tadup = htk3_9c7

## Step 4 — Deploy the Reconciliation Job

Promote the Ledgerline reconciliation job to the prod scheduler after the staging dry run passes. The job compares warehouse counts against the Tallybook system nightly; mismatches above threshold open tickets automatically. Confirm the cron window doesn't overlap the import batch. The scheduler only accepts signed job bundles, so sign the build before upload. Sign with the following deploy key.

rollout seal: bky4_DFM9